BLACK GIRLS ROCK SHOW MOMENTS

Jill Scott

Jill Scott
The one and only Jilly from Philly opened up the show by singing “Golden.” The crowd went wild!
 
 
 
Nia Long

Nia Long
Our host Nia Long rocked the stage all night with beauty, style and grace. 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
Raven-Symoné.

Raven-Symoné.
Raven-Symoné received the first honor of the night, the Young, Gifted and Black award
 
 
 
Keyshia Cole

Keyshia Cole
While performing “I Remember,” Keyshia Cole reminded us why she’s one of the most passionate singers in the game.
 
 
Rev. Dr. Iyanla Vanzant

Rev. Dr. Iyanla Vanzant
Rev. Dr. Iyanla Vanzant got a standing ovation when she took the stage to accept her Motivator award.
 
 
 
Ruby Dee

Ruby Dee
Actress Lynn Whitfield presented the iconic Ruby Dee with the Living Legend award.
 
 
Shontelle

Shontelle
Bajan artist Shontelle performed her chart-topping single “Impossible.”
 
 
 
Ciara

Ciara
Ciara presented the Visionary award to Missy Elliott, one of her best friends.
 
 
 
VV Brown

VV Brown
UK artist VV Brown, performing “Shark in the Water,” held it down in a lineup that featured heavyweights.
 
Keri Hilson

Keri Hilson
Keri Hilson had the women in the audience nodding their heads in agreement as she sang “Breaking Point.”
 
Monica

Monica
Monica’s performance of “Still Standing” was flawless. She even had the audience pumping their fists!

 
 
Missy Elliott

Missy Elliott
Missy fittingly delivered an inspirational speech when she took the stage to accept her Visionary award.
 
 
Four Women

Four Women
Marsha Ambrosius, Ledisi, Jill Scott and Kelly Price brought the house down with a memorable cover of Nina Simone’s “Four Women.”
